WebJun 2, 2016 · Because the MUE for CPT code 69209 is 2, you would append modifier -50 to report that the ear lavage was performed in both ears if both ears had impacted cerumen. CMS limits payment for CPT code 69210 to earwax removal during visits that meet all of the following criteria: Cerumen removal is the only reason for the visit. WebAug 29, 2024 · Ear irrigation, also known as ear lavage, is a procedure to remove ear wax that can build up in the ear canal and block part or all of it. Ear wax, or cerumen, is a substance with antibacterial properties made by glands in your outer ears. It mixes with dead cells and hair to form a barrier that protects the middle and inner ear from dirt and ...
